Dad and Josh are joined by Anne Marie for New Year's Eve wines. Josh's Champagne was Pierre Gimonnet Blanc de Blanc.  Josh brings popcorn with two different sauces. One sauce was a Sichuan Chili crisp and the other was Zhong sauce.  Both were made by Fly By Jing.  He also brings Duckham, and Porchetta di Parma. Dad brings the J. Lassalle Premier Cru Champaign.  His sides were planned to match a New Year's Eve or Christmas meal.  He brings Prime Rib, steamed Broccoli and a simple baked potato.  Marie brings Chandon Brut sparkling wine.  For her sides she brings an amazing cheese, garlic bread,  cheese mushroom caps and Ferrero Rocher chocolate cups.  She tells about her special connection with Chandon wines on three continents.  They have a great time sipping and snacking!
